Aleksandra Borkowska
Summary
Aleksandra Borkowska is a human[1]. She was born in Usarzów[2]. She was born on January 1, 1828[3]. She passed away in Warsaw[4]. She died on January 1, 1898[5]. She worked as a literary scholar[6] and journalist[7].
